Cornicabra from Casas de Hualdo is a monovarietal olive oil made exclusively from the indigenous Cornicabra variety, which is characteristic of the Montes de Toledo area. This variety is known for its robust nature and resilience, producing oils with a rich structure and intense aromatic profile.
The oil is extracted from carefully handpicked olives that are cold-pressed shortly after harvesting, preserving all their nutritional and organoleptic qualities. The flavor profile of Cornicabra oil is intense and complex — dominated by notes of green almond, tomato, artichoke, and green leaves, with pronounced bitterness and a persistent spiciness. This oil is especially appreciated by those who favor stronger, more distinctive flavors, and pairs excellently with red meat dishes, aged cheeses, and grilled vegetables.
Producer
Casas de Hualdo is a prestigious Spanish producer of extra virgin olive oil, located in the heart of the Toledo region, on the banks of the Tajo River. Their estate covers nearly 4,000 hectares and is home to more than 300,000 olive trees.
It was founded by Francisco Riberas in 1986 and is now recognized as one of the leaders in olive oil production in Spain. They offer four single-variety oils: Picual, Cornicabra, Manzanilla, and Arbequina, as well as blends like Reserva de Familia. Their Picual oil is especially valued for its intense fruity aroma and complex flavor. Casas de Hualdo is also distinguished by its commitment to sustainability.
They have installed one of the largest photovoltaic irrigation systems in Spain, covering about 370 hectares of olive groves and other crops. Additionally, they use modern irrigation systems and implement ecological practices to protect plant and animal life.
